Woh Kehte Hain Humse Lyrics - Dariya Dil




Woh Kehte Hain Humse Lyrics from Dariya Dil is Hindi song sung by Nitin Mukesh and music is given by Rajesh Roshan. Woh Kehte Hain Humse song lyrics are written by Indeevar. Dariya Dil is a 1988 Hindi movie starring Govinda, Kimi Katkar and Roshni.

The song "Woh Kehte Hain Humse" by Nitin Mukesh reflects on the innocence and passion of youth in love. It talks about how some people caution against love at a young age, unaware of the beauty and spontaneity of youthful feelings. The lyrics compare love to the blossoming of flowers in spring, and express that love doesn't heed age or reason. It paints a picture of nature's beauty, where even the changing seasons and the company of stars and rivers are not alone. Ultimately, it celebrates the purity and inevitability of love, despite others' warnings.

Woh Kehte Hain Humse Song Popular Phrases

1. Abhi umar nahi hai pyaar ki
This phrase suggests that according to others, we are too young to understand love fully. They consider us naive, unaware of the complexities and depths of love's experiences.

2. Nadaan hain woh kya jaanein
Here, the lyrics express that those who caution us about love may themselves be naive or ignorant about the true essence of love. They may not understand the spontaneity and natural flow of love.

3. Kab kali khili bahaar ki
This line metaphorically refers to the unpredictability of when love will blossom, much like how one cannot predict when flowers will bloom in spring. It implies that love follows its own timing, beyond human control or prediction.

4. Yeh baat nahi ikhtiyar ki
This phrase conveys the idea that matters of the heart are not under one's control. Love happens spontaneously and cannot be forced or directed by rational decision-making. It emphasizes the emotional and uncontrollable nature of love.
